Russia’s complete-measure attack away from Ukraine in the pressed countless Ukrainians to look for haven abroad, of many fleeing for the member claims of one’s European union, for example those that edging Ukraine. Poland spotted one of the largest influxes from refugees, and you may 16 weeks toward drama, nearly one million Ukrainian refugees continue to reside in the nation. This new entryway of these a high number of refugees – and such as for example a premier proportion regarding older refugees – on European union member says is actually unprecedented.

“Everybody has their particular tale, but it hurts us a comparable” Training about knowledge away from old Ukrainian refugees within the Poland (EN/PL)

Towards the almost all knowledge into the dispute concentrating on Ukrainian refugees general, and because much of the existing training centers around younger society communities, it declaration will bring a better analysis on the need, demands and you will welfare regarding old Ukrainians from inside the Poland. It places the latest voices away from more mature Ukrainian refugees on centre – gathered courtesy decimal survey, interview and focus class talks – and you will goes with them with interviews having secret stakeholders doing work in thought, controlling and you may providing features to Ukrainian refugees. The brand new conclusions show that older Ukrainian refugees in Poland deal with monetary low self-esteem, uncertainty regarding the future and you can enough traps for the accessing needed recommendations, features and you will pointers. That it statement sets pass ideas on how exactly to boost the welfare out-of more mature Ukrainian refugees from inside the Poland and you may instructions as learnt money for hard times.

Eighty-five % from refugees we talked to because of it report are not involved in Poland, merely ten per cent features a full otherwise area-go out employment and 5 per cent provides abnormal or regular performs. Brand new conclusions inform you old refugees deal with barriers to locate are employed in Poland, for instance the threat of shedding toward casual a career. Provided exactly how reduced the common Ukrainian pension was, really more mature refugees are dependent on funding in the Polish state, family relations, and you will, to help you a significantly minimal education, financial assistance out-of NGOs and you can Shine machines. Properties went from the the elderly convey more minimal resources of income than just properties having a minumum of one people out-of a working many years. The newest findings let you know the need to write a lengthier-label method that will promote earlier refugees monetary security to fulfill their earliest need.

Study conclusions make sure earlier Ukrainian refugees provides a good use of the one-out-of cash recommendations offered to most of the Ukrainian refugees by Polish bodies and universal county nearest and dearest positives, like child service. But not, access to public cover mechanisms if you do not performs owed in order to decades, handicap, otherwise hard financial things, is found to be so much more troublesome.

Rooms stays one of the several enough time-title pressures to possess older Ukrainian refugees from inside the Poland. In the course of the newest survey, nearly 50 % of participants rented their holiday accommodation and you can 50 % of benefitted regarding some kind of rooms support. Properties headed because of the seniors were discovered to be alot more established with the holiday accommodation support than simply households which have one people working age. The results inform you a strong dependence on brand new continuation out-of holiday accommodation assistance schemes, for example use rumensk kvinner of collective shelters cost-free or rental subsidies having Shine hosts for from the-risk more mature refugees just who cannot afford the expense of rent. New withdrawal of such support could place old refugees at stake regarding perception compelled to return to Ukraine, living in suboptimal requirements if not homelessness.

Of many old Ukrainian refugees want medical attention and you will triggerred accessibility the newest Polish health care program. Sixty-you to percent enjoys a handicap as the measured because of the Washington Category Short Seriously interested in Performing (WG-SS), 70 percent enjoys a persistent issues otherwise severe health problem and you may 64 per cent read treatment and take medication. Much time prepared times to possess specialist care, vocabulary barriers and shortage of recommendations have been identified as an element of the pressures in the opening health care when you look at the Poland. The majority of old Ukrainian refugees questioned for this data struggle to pay for their bodies-related expenses, with just 8 percent having the ability to spend its medical costs completely. The 3 chief health-relevant will cost you which they struggle to fulfill is drug, specialised cures and you will doctor appointments. The study showcased the need to support old Ukrainian refugees for the conference their health-related will cost you.
